<!--
`iron-a11y-announcer` is a singleton element that is intended to add a11y
to features that require on-demand announcement from screen readers. In
order to make use of the announcer, it is best to request its availability
in the announcing element.

Example:

    Polymer({

      is: 'x-chatty',

      attached: function() {
        // This will create the singleton element if it has not
        // been created yet:
        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.requestAvailability();
      }
    });

After the `iron-a11y-announcer` has been made available, elements can
make announces by firing bubbling `iron-announce` events.

Example:

    this.fire('iron-announce', {
      text: 'This is an announcement!'
    }, { bubbles: true });

Note: announcements are only audible if you have a screen reader enabled.

@group Iron Elements
@demo demo/index.html
-->

<dom-module id="iron-a11y-announcer">
  <template>
    <style>
      :host {
        display: inline-block;
        position: fixed;
        clip: rect(0px,0px,0px,0px);
      }
    </style>
    <div aria-live$="[[mode]]">[[_text]]</div>
  </template>
</dom-module>
<script>
'use strict';
(function() {
  'use strict';
  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er = Polymer({
    is: 'iron-a11y-announcer',

    properties: {

      /**
        * The value of mode is used to set the `aria-live` attribute
        * for the element that will be announced. Valid values are: `off`,
        * `polite` and `assertive`.
        */
      mode: {
        type: String,
        value: 'polite'
      },

      _text: {
        type: String,
        value: ''
      }
    },

    created: function() {
      if (!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.instance) {
        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.instance = this;
      }

      document.body.addEventListener('iron-announce', this._onIronAnnounce.bind(this));
    },

    /**
      * Cause a text string to be announced by screen readers.
      *
      * @param {string} text The text that should be announced.
      */
    announce: function(text) {
      this._text = '';
      this.async(function() {
        this._text = text;
      }, 100);
    },

    _onIronAnnounce: function(event) {
      if (event.detail && event.detail.text) {
        this.announce(event.detail.text);
      }
    }
  });

  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.instance = null;

  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.requestAvailability = function() {
    if (!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.instance) {
      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.instance = document.createElement('iron-a11y-announcer');
    }

    document.body.appendChild(Polymer.IronA11yAnnouncer.instance);
  };
})();

</script>
